It establishes the point in history when mankind's exciting new tool, the computer, came of age and competed with its human creators in the ultimate intellectual competition: a game of chess. The text chronicles one of the great technology achievements of the 20th Century. The heroes are: IBM researchers Feng-hsiung Hsu, Murray Campbell, and Joe Hoane, along with team leader Chung-Jen Tan and International Grandmaster Joel Benjamin. The text examines the progress made by the creators of Deep Blue, beginning with the1989 two-game match against Kasparov. Where next after 7nm? How long will it take to double Rome's performance? Probably a good idea because Vincent's double null move check or Omid's null move verification had not yet been invented. They did not use much pruning because they were wary of overlooking tactics. The 480 chess CPUs were not just move generators, they also participated in the evaluation process. Their instructions were things like "Rxc4" and the like.
Deep Blue is not like most other chess programs.
